VeuReu commited on
Commit
4f4a005
·
verified ·
1 Parent(s): 39e9f1d

Upload 2 files

Browse files
Files changed (2) hide show
  1. Dockerfile +1 -1
  2. requirements.txt +13 -10
Dockerfile CHANGED
@@ -2,7 +2,7 @@ FROM python:3.11-slim
2
 
3
  # Dependencias del sistema necesarias para vídeo/ocr (ajusta si no las usas)
4
  RUN apt-get update && apt-get install -y --no-install-recommends \
5
- ffmpeg libsm6 libxext6 libgl1 tesseract-ocr libsndfile1 \
6
  && rm -rf /var/lib/apt/lists/*
7
 
8
  WORKDIR /app
 
2
 
3
  # Dependencias del sistema necesarias para vídeo/ocr (ajusta si no las usas)
4
  RUN apt-get update && apt-get install -y --no-install-recommends \
5
+ ffmpeg libsndfile1 libsm6 libxext6 libgl1 tesseract-ocr \
6
  && rm -rf /var/lib/apt/lists/*
7
 
8
  WORKDIR /app
requirements.txt CHANGED
@@ -4,23 +4,26 @@ python-multipart==0.0.9
4
  PyYAML>=6.0
5
  requests>=2.32
6
  gradio_client>=0.16.0
7
-
8
  numpy>=1.26
9
  Pillow>=10.4
10
  opencv-python-headless==4.10.0.84
11
-
12
- librosa>=0.10
13
- soundfile>=0.12
14
- pydub>=0.25
15
- ffmpeg-python>=0.2
16
-
17
  scikit-learn>=1.5
18
  sentence-transformers>=3.0
19
  transformers>=4.44
20
- torch==2.3.0
21
- torchaudio==2.3.0
22
-
23
  chromadb>=0.5.4
24
  moviepy>=2.0
25
  tenacity>=8.2
26
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
4
  PyYAML>=6.0
5
  requests>=2.32
6
  gradio_client>=0.16.0
 
7
  numpy>=1.26
8
  Pillow>=10.4
9
  opencv-python-headless==4.10.0.84
 
 
 
 
 
 
10
  scikit-learn>=1.5
11
  sentence-transformers>=3.0
12
  transformers>=4.44
 
 
 
13
  chromadb>=0.5.4
14
  moviepy>=2.0
15
  tenacity>=8.2
16
 
17
+ # Pytorch
18
+ torch==2.3.0
19
+ torchaudio==2.3.0
20
+
21
+ # Pyannote
22
+ pyannote.audio==3.1.1
23
+ huggingface_hub>=0.23
24
+
25
+ # Audio y utilidades
26
+ librosa>=0.10
27
+ soundfile>=0.12
28
+ pydub>=0.25
29
+ ffmpeg-python>=0.2